description | Natural dye was successfully solubilised in aqueous solution in forming inclusion complex
with β-cyclodextrin (β-CD). To investigate molecular association, phase solubility studies
were undertaken. In the presence of cyclodextrin, fluorescence absorbances were
enhanced. Solid state inclusion complex was also prepared using co-precipitation method.
The solid was characterized using Fourier Transform Infrared (FTIR) and X-ray
Diffractometer (XRD). Using FTIR, the host-interaction have been evidenced by
monitoring the changes in some guest molecule band relative to those observed in the
spectra of the 1:1 physical mixtures and complex. XRD can give the order of structure in
the solid inclusion. All the data from FTIR and X-Ray studies showed that it is possible to
obtain an inclusion complex (1:1) in solid state. |
